
Behavioral science plays a pivotal role in improving animal welfare by offering insights into animal behavior, cognition, and emotions. Understanding how animals think, feel, and react helps researchers, veterinarians, and caretakers to create environments and practices that better meet the needs of animals in various settings. Behavioral science bridges the gap between scientific knowledge and practical care, influencing everything from animal husbandry to conservation efforts and zoo management. It is particularly useful in interpreting how animals respond to their surroundings and interact with humans, allowing for the design of spaces that reduce stress and promote well-being.
One of the key aspects of behavioral science in animal welfare is the study of stress and its effects on animals. Animals experience stress in many forms, such as from poor living conditions, overcrowding, or inadequate socialization. Behavioral scientists observe and analyze these stressors, helping to identify how they impact health, growth, and reproduction. By understanding the root causes of stress, appropriate strategies can be implemented to minimize these triggers and improve overall health. This could involve enriching the environment with appropriate stimuli, changing social structures, or adjusting feeding practices to promote mental stimulation and physical activity.
Furthermore, behavioral science contributes to enhancing the human-animal relationship. Animals, particularly those in domestic environments, often interact with humans on a daily basis. Positive interactions, such as training and gentle handling, can improve the animals' trust and reduce aggression. Training techniques based on positive reinforcement, for example, allow animals to learn desired behaviors in a stress-free and supportive manner. This not only improves the quality of life for the animals but also strengthens the bond between them and their human caretakers.
In wildlife conservation, behavioral science is instrumental in understanding the behaviors of endangered species and improving their chances of survival. Observing how animals interact with their environment, find food, and reproduce can inform conservation efforts, ensuring that animals are provided with habitats that support natural behaviors. Similarly, when animals are relocated for conservation purposes, behavioral research helps assess their likelihood of adapting to new environments and integrating into different social groups, which is crucial for the success of reintroduction programs.
Additionally, behavioral science helps ensure that animals in research environments are treated humanely. Ethical considerations are increasingly integral to scientific research, and behavioral science provides essential tools to ensure that animals are not subjected to unnecessary harm. By observing and understanding animal reactions to different conditions, researchers can create more humane and ethical protocols for animal testing.
Behavioral science continues to be an essential field for advancing animal welfare, offering profound insights into how we can better understand and care for animals. Through its application, we can improve the living conditions of both domestic and wild animals, ensuring they lead healthier, happier lives.
